Project aims to tackle Dublin's homeless problem

An emergency accommodation project targeting young homeless people with addiction problems was launched in Dublin today.

The two agencies behind the project, Focus Ireland and the Society of St Vincent de Paul, called for greater government commitment to tackle homelessness in the city.
